So you Have never bet horses before? Oh fk it's fun. Time to wet your beak on some horses. It's not rocket science so you can pick it up pretty quick.
I like Good magic. Justify is the heavy fav here and a safe bet all around. It's going to be a tall order to beat him. He's racing against a smaller pack now. Sporting Chance is a solid play for the Place & Show bets. Bravazo is a sexy pick @ 20/1 odds. Be cautious with him though.
Throw in an Exacta bet. You can bet these too: Win bet, Place bet, show bet.
An exacta bet is a bet where you pick two horses to finish in the first and second place positions.
Then there's an Exacta Box bet. So by boxing your selections, the two horses can finish in any order. This also allows you to choose more than two horses. So for example, if you choose three horses in a boxed exacta, any two of your horses need to finish first and second – but you now have six possible combinations.
Win, place, show, or first, second and third. When you bet on the winner, you simply get the horse at its odds and if it wins, you cash that amount. So $10 on a horse at 12-to-1 nets you $120. If you bet on a horse to "place," or come in second, the payout is less, and same goes for "show."
You can make an "across the board" wager on a horse. It's where you bet on that horse to win, place and show. If the horse wins, you collect all three.
Bottom line bud to find value you'll need to look to the Exacta, Trifecta, Pick 4, Pick 5 or Pick 6. Safest money is on Justify. Really is. But value isn't great so depending on what you want to spend is the key.
